 If in MUGSI you have your primary email address as your Hotmail, then anything sent to ****@mcmaster.ca will go straight to your Hotmail, but not to your MUSS. This could explain the extra emails that are only in your Hotmail.
 
In summary:  
1.) emails to ****@cis.muss.mcmaste  r.ca will appear in both MUSS and Hotmail. 
2.) emails to ****@mcmaster.ca will appear only in Hotmail.
 
(Someone else explained this to me in a post here, and I sent a bunch of test emails and this is how it seems to work.)

 UTS does all the tech stuff.
 
In MUGSI you should be able to change your primary e-mail address (My Profile). Change it to either @muss.cis.mcmaster.ca   or to @hotmail.com. All e-mails sent to @mcmaster.ca will go to your primary e-mail address. All e-mails sent to @muss.cis.mcmaster.ca   automatically go to your McMaster inbox.
